Alexander Mattison Ruled Out for Week 15 vs Bengals



Mattison was never going to produce a whole lot anyway this week even if he was healthy, but his absence opens the door for Ty Chandler to become the clear No. 1 back in Minnesota’s backfield against the Bengals. The Vikings are hoping to get some sort of spark on offense out of the recently anointed starting quarterback Nick Mullens, and any life on offense compared to what we’ve seen from Minnesota after these past few games would only stand to benefit Chandler in his first game as the starter. He’ll be strictly a volume based play this week and check in as a mid-low RB2, but in a week where injuries are aplenty and running backs are receiving ‘unknown’ designations heading into their games, Chandler is absolutely worth a look in your lineup as a flex/RB3.
